在大数据处理领域,HBase作为一款分布式、可扩展🐸的非关系型数据库,其存储容量上限一直是人们关注的焦点。随着数据量的爆炸式增长,了解HBase的存储能力及其扩展方式对于构建高效的数据处理系统至关重要。本文将深入探讨HBase的存储容量上限,并结合最新相关热点话题,为读者提供有价值的见解。

HBase的单表存储能力
HBase的单表可以支持千亿行、百万列的数据规模,数据容量可以达到TB甚至PB级别。这一特性使得HBase成为处理大规模数据集的理想选择。例如,在日志处理、实时数据采集、用户画像等场景中,HBa🍇PG电子平台se能够轻松应对海量数据的存储需求。此外,HBase还支持灵活的表结构设计,允许用户根据实际需求调整行键和列族,以优化存储布局和查询效率。
HBase集群的扩展性
HBase集群的扩展性是确保其能够支持大容量存储的关键。通过增加RegionServer节点和DataNode节点,HBase集群可以轻松地扩展存储和处理能力。RegionServer节点负责处理数据的读写操作,而DataNode节点则负责数据的存储。这种分布式的架构使得HBase能够轻松应对数据量的增长,同时保持高性能和稳定性。根据最新热点话题,随着云计算和大数据🏮PG电子平台技术的不断发展,HBase的集群扩展性得到了进一步的提升,能够更好地满足企业对数据存储和处理能力的需求。
HBase存储空间的配置与优化
虽然HBase具有强大的存储能力,但其最大存储空间仍然受到多个因素的限制,包括HBase的版本、集群配置和硬件资源等。为了最大化HBase的存储空间,用户需要合理设置表空间大小、优化表结构以及合理设置行键和列族。例如,通过调整`hbase.hregion.max.bytes`参数,用户可以设置HBase的表空间大小,从而控制单个Region的大小和数量。此外,优化表结构可以减少冗余数据,提高数据利用率。通过定期检视和调整HBase的存储空间使用情况,用户可以确保HBase的存储空间充足且高效利用。
HBase在大数据处理中的应用与挑战
作为大数据处理领域的佼佼者,HBase在实际应用中面临着诸多挑战。其中,热点问题是一个值得关注的话题。由于HBase是分布式的系统,数据被存储在不同的节点上,如果数据分布不均匀或某些数据被频繁访问,就会导致热点问题的产生。热点问题会导致热点节点的负载过高,进而影响整个系统的性能。为了解决这个问题,用户需要优化数据访问模式、调整数据分布以及调整系统参数等。🎲此外,随着数据量的不断增长,如何保持HBase的高性能和稳定性也是一个持续的挑战。
综上所述,HBase在存储容量方面具有显著的优势,其单表可以支持千亿行、百万列的数据规模,同时集群扩展性也使得其能够轻松应对数据量的增长。然而,为了最大化HBase的存储空间并应对实际应用中的挑战,用户需要合理设置表空间大小、优化表结构以及关注热点问题等。随着云计算和大数据技术的不断发展,HBase将继续在大数据处理领域发挥重要作用,为企业提供高效、稳定的数据存储和处理解决方案。
